CVE:CVE-2007-0445 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-03 14:27:56.728903 |
Details available
Heap-based buffer overflow in the arj.ppl module in the OnDemand Scanner in Kaspersky Anti-Virus, Anti-Virus for Workstations, and Anti-Virus for File Servers 6.0, and Internet Security 6.0 before Maintenance Pack 2 build 6.0.2.614 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ted ARJ archives.
Published: 2007-04-06T00:00:00.000Z
Updated: 2024-08-07T12:19:30.325Z |
